Ulster 100 jeździ w tym roku z nowym, trzecim już silnikiem. Tym razem jest to czterocylindrowa jednostka Meadows o pojemności 1496 cm³. Samochód ten ma zmieniony numer rejestracyjny (FMC 120). Shelsley model
is a supercharged two-seater, suitable for both road work and
production sports car events (Brooklands, Shelsley Walsh and other
hill climbs, speed trials, road races and similar events). The
1496-cc four-cylinder engine is the same as used in the TT
Replica and Ulster 100 models, except for the twin-supercharging
equipment. It has a tubular front axle with inverted semi-elliptic
leaf springs, acting as cantilevers, and adjustable rigid radius
rods below the axle. In touring trim (£850) the car has a
maximum road speed of 105 mph.
